Abstract

Aug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) supports communication
process of people who have communication disabilities and is based on the use
of symbols. Multidisciplinary research is undertaken aiming to explore and create
interoperable and scalable symbol based communication services for different user
devices. The paper introduces model of the platform architecture for developing
and deploying symbol based communication services and describes a model of
adaptive symbol based AAC application.
